West Ham United have made a disastrous start to the season and have already told manager Graham Potter exactly when he will be sacked.

Article continues under the video

The Hammers slumped to a 3-0 loss away to Sunderland on the opening weekend of the Premier League campaign before being humiliated 5-1 at home against Chelsea on Friday.

The West Ham support made their feelings towards the current regime clear during the derby loss, with the London Stadium largely empty by the time the full-time whistle was blown.

Now owner David Sullivan is ready to take action, according to TBR Football.

It is claimed that the Hammers boss has been “rocked” by the performances of the team so far. And now Potter has been given just two matches to turn things around with the Hammers or else face losing his job.

Next up for West Ham is a trip to Wolves in the EFL Cup second round on 26 August, followed by a Premier League clash with Nottingham Forest on 31 August.

Moyes regret?

West Ham have failed to find any consistent form since parting company with David Moyes in the summer of 2024. The Scotsman’s brand of football was seen as dull by supporters, yet it brought the club European success in the form of the Conference League title.

Julen Lopetegui failed to build on the momentum of Moyes and lasted a matter of months before being replaced by Potter, whose performance has been even worse.

Potter has won only five of 21 West Ham matches since taking charge, giving him a win percentage of just 23.8%.
